Cannabis shake? You will not find cannabis shakes at Sonic or Dairy Queen. There is nothing new about cannabis shake. However, this cannabis culture has increased consumer interest and changed some habits.
Cannabis shakes are the leftovers from all your cannabis use. It includes all the bits, pieces, and crumbs from the weed you have processed into joints, stuffed pipes, and fed to grinders. With cannabis prices as high as they are, users try to stretch and capture everything they can. You might consider cannabis shake as your recycling bin.
The loose cannabis flower will stick to the side of pipes and grinders and drop to the bottom of baggies and commercial packaging. What you have are the assorted remnants of your various strains. That lets you save money on the best strain and combine the good, bad, and ugly.

Cannabis shake sells at lower prices than whole buds—top 10 Highest CBD Cannabis Strains of 2021. The lower price attracts many cannabis customers. But it does not deliver unless you work at it a little.
Labeling does not always include the strain from which the shake accumulated. Commercial dispensaries package the leftovers from multiple strains. That means you get something substantial or something stale. Cannabis processors, seeing market potential, will package shakes from specific strains promising desired potency or medical effects. These premium packages will go for one price, while bags of assorted stuff will sell at much lower prices.
Knowing what you want, where to get it, and what to spend requires some experience and sophistication.

It would be best if you remembered that cannabis shake is broken down goods. You will not enjoy the same experience you would from the whole flower. If you want to roll a joint or pack a pipe, use the prime strain.
You can roll the shake, and dispensaries will sell pre-rolls packed with shake. As such, the shake is a convenient, low-priced way of extending the product you are using. It also works as an addition to edible recipes. The fine material will blend effortlessly into food chemistry to provide a mild cannabinoid influence.
However, if you want potent psychoactive effects, you must look for top-shelf packages. If you wish for medical benefits, you will not have control over dosing.
You might collect your shake from cannabis you use in different formats. Scoop it up and store it in dark glass containers in a cool, dark place.
